Let’s start by getting to know what a Delta robot is. A Delta robot is a type of parallel robot. It’s got this cool design with three arms connected to a base and a moving platform at the end. This setup gives it some amazing features. It’s super fast, can move with high precision, and has a relatively large working area considering its size.

One of the main reasons a Delta robot is great for sorting is its speed. In a high – volume production environment, speed is crucial. A Delta robot can pick and place items at an incredibly fast rate. It can make hundreds of picks per minute, which is way faster than a human worker. For instance, in a fruit – sorting line, it can quickly grab apples, oranges, or bananas and place them in the right containers. This high – speed operation means that more products can be sorted in less time, increasing the overall productivity of the sorting process.
Another important factor is precision. Sorting often requires accurate placement of items. A Delta robot can position items with very high precision, usually within a few millimeters. In the electronics industry, where tiny components are involved, this precision is essential. It can ensure that each component is placed exactly where it needs to be, reducing the chances of errors and improving the quality of the sorted products.
The flexibility of a Delta robot also makes it suitable for sorting tasks. It can be easily programmed to handle different types of items. Whether it’s small, lightweight objects or larger, heavier ones, the robot can adjust its movements accordingly. For example, if you’re sorting small screws one day and then large bolts the next, you can just change the programming of the robot, and it will be ready to go.
In addition, Delta robots can work in different environments. They can be used in cleanrooms for sorting delicate electronic components or in harsh industrial environments for sorting heavy – duty parts. They are designed to be robust and reliable, which means they can operate continuously without a lot of downtime.
Let’s take a look at some real – world examples. In a chocolate factory, a Delta robot is used to sort different types of chocolates. It can quickly pick up chocolates of different shapes, sizes, and flavors and place them in the right boxes. This not only speeds up the packaging process but also ensures that the chocolates are sorted accurately. In a recycling plant, a Delta robot can sort different types of waste materials, such as plastics, metals, and paper. It can identify the materials using sensors and then place them in the appropriate bins.
However, there are also some challenges when using a Delta robot for sorting tasks. One of the challenges is the cost. Delta robots can be quite expensive to purchase and install. But when you consider the long – term benefits, such as increased productivity and reduced labor costs, the investment can be worth it. Another challenge is the need for proper programming and maintenance. You need to have skilled technicians who can program the robot to perform the sorting tasks correctly and who can keep the robot in good working condition.
Now, let’s talk about how we can make the most of a Delta robot for sorting tasks. First, you need to choose the right type of Delta robot for your specific sorting needs. There are different models available, with different payload capacities, working areas, and speeds. You need to consider factors such as the size and weight of the items you’re sorting, the volume of the sorting task, and the required precision.
Second, you need to integrate the Delta robot with other equipment in your sorting line. This may include conveyor belts, sensors, and vision systems. The conveyor belts can bring the items to the robot, the sensors can detect the position and characteristics of the items, and the vision systems can help the robot identify the items more accurately.
Third, you need to train your staff to work with the Delta robot. They need to understand how to operate the robot, how to program it, and how to troubleshoot any problems that may arise.
